Loyola University New Orleans is located in New Orleans, LA.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 31 business administration & management degrees were awarded at Loyola University New Orleans.

Studying Online at Loyola University New Orleans

Online coursework is an option at Loyola University New Orleans. Among 4,250 students, 608 (14%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 1,348 (32%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Business Administration & Management Graduates from Loyola University New Orleans

Those who finish Loyola University New Orleans’s Business Administration & Management program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Business Administration & Management at Loyola University New Orleans
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$27,933
2 years $35,060

Median Debt at Graduation

The median debt for Business Administration & Management graduates from Loyola University New Orleans comes in at $27,000.

Student Demographics & Diversity

The following sections describe the diversity of Business Administration & Management graduates at Loyola University New Orleans, broken down by degree level.

Across all degree levels, Business Administration & Management graduates at Loyola University New Orleans are 39% women (12) and 61% men (19).

Business Administration & Management Bachelor’s Program at Loyola University New Orleans

Of the 28 bachelor’s business administration & management degrees awarded at Loyola University New Orleans, 36% were women (10) and 64% were men (18).
